X Stream C E X i X *F- I P F_pherneral Intermittent Perennial Explanation: The stream(s) listed abotie has been located on the most recent published NRCS Soil Surrey of Chatham COUnty, North Carolina and; or the most recent copy of the uSGS Topographic map at a 1:24.000 scale. Each stream that is checked "Not Subject" has been determined to not be at least intermittent or is not present. Streams that are checked "Subject'" have been located on the property and possess characteristics that qualify it to be at least an intermittent stream. There may be other streams located on the property that do not sho%r up on the maps referenced aboNe but may be considered jurisdictional according to the LS Army Corps of Engineers. 'Nothing Compares This on-site determination shall expire five (5) years from the date of this letter. Landowners or affected parties that dispute a determination made by the DNVR may request a determination by the Director. An appeal request must be made within sixty (60) days of date of this letter.
